Galvanized steel sheets are steel sheets coated with zinc. The zinc coating protects the steel against corrosion, ensuring its durability and longevity. Galvanized steel sheets are used for a number of purposes, including roofing, siding, fence, and industrial equipment.

The cost-effectiveness of galvanized steel sheets
Galvanized steel sheets have a greater starting cost than alternative materials like ungalvanized steel or aluminum. However, galvanized steel sheets may provide considerable long-term cost reductions.
Galvanized steel sheets need minimal to no upkeep, saving money on painting and other maintenance expenses. Furthermore, galvanized steel sheets may survive for decades, saving money on replacement expenses.
According to a research conducted by the American Galvanizers Association, galvanized steel roofing may save up to 50% on maintenance expenditures during the roof's lifespan. The research also discovered that galvanized steel roofing may last up to 50 years, saving money on replacement expenses.
